Medical Malpractice

A birth injury can have devastating consequences that can last a lifetime. A successful lawsuit could help parents receive justice and secure compensation for 85.215.118.43 the future care of their child in the event that an error in medical care caused the injury.

The first step in pursuing a medical malpractice claim is to find an experienced lawyer. A reputable birth trauma lawyer will collaborate with medical experts and look over records to identify any potential malpractice. They will also discuss the case in depth with you and answer any questions you might have.

Medical negligence lawsuits can be complex and require difficult witnesses. Teams of lawyers are on the side of doctors, hospitals and insurance companies who are trained to reduce or deny payments. It is crucial to find a lawyer who is able to fight these formidable adversaries.

A medical malpractice claim has four parts: duty breach, causation and damages. A birth injury lawyer who has experience will help you collect evidence and create strong legal arguments to support each of these elements.

In the case of a birth injury, the first step is to establish that your doctor had an official relationship with you. This could be accomplished through medical records or hospital bills. It is then important to establish that the doctor was obligated to you a duty to act with reasonable care and skill that you would expect from a different medical provider in the same situation.

Birth Injury

A birth injury lawyer can help families bring a medical negligence lawsuit against a doctor or hospital who committed negligence during labor and delivery. A successful legal case could result in financial compensation which can help a family pay for their child's present and future medical expenses, lost wages and emotional trauma.

A experienced birth injury lawyer will be able to go through your child's medical records and identify any possible acts of negligence, and also hire experts (often other OB/GYN physicians) to examine the case and give their opinion regarding whether there was malpractice. After the experts have examined your case your lawyer will be competent to determine who is accountable for the injuries and identify them as defendants in the lawsuit.

In New York and most other states, there is a statute of limitations that specifies the deadline for filing claims. This is usually 30 months or 2 1/2 years following the incident.

During this period your attorney will negotiate a settlement with your insurance company on behalf of you. Your attorney will file a suit in the appropriate court if the insurance company refuses to pay a reasonable amount. A judge and jury will then decide on the issue. This is a lengthy process that should only be handled by an experienced professional.

Insurance

The advancements in medicine have made childbirth relatively safer however, there are still dangers. Medical professionals and doctors must exercise caution to avoid making mistakes that could result in permanent consequences for the mother and child. If they do not take care, they could be held responsible and forced to pay for damages.

Birth injury attorneys can help parents get fair compensation for future and past medical expenses and also non-economic damages such as pain and suffering. Their expertise can also be helpful during settlement negotiations for insurance and in avoiding the aggressive tactics malpractice insurers use to reduce payouts. If needed an attorney could take your case to court.

A lot of medical malpractice claims go to court without trial, and this is often the case with birth injuries. A medical malpractice lawyer can construct a solid claim to recover compensation through the review of medical records of the child and hiring medical experts.

A seasoned New York City birth injury law firm can look over the medical records and request diagnostic studies and reports that analyze the extent of the injuries, and also identify the defendants. This could include the obstetrician, surgeons, nurses and doctors involved in the birth or delivery, as well as the hospitals. In certain states, parents can apply for a state program which provides compensation to children who suffer from certain birth injuries, such as brain damage or paralysis.
